About the Job

The Software Development Engineer will be part of a lab organization that supports the design engineering teams in equipment support and development for product validation testing. Responsibilities will include designing, developing, and maintaining software applications for use in an industrial lab environment. This person will lead development projects, working with engineering teams to understand project scope and important milestones. This position is part of a larger team of engineers that support our equipment development. Strong analytical and problem-solving skills are important, as well as experience in various programming languages.



Successful candidates will be able to:

  • Lead software development projects

  • Communicate and collaborate with cross-functional engineering teams

  • Discuss and construct a strategy for architecture within Sensata

  • Maintain and optimize existing software solutions

  • Work well in a team environment

  • Guide and mentor other engineers as needed

  • Work hands on, onsite >80% of the time

  • Create and maintain clear documentation for software solutions

Since 1963, Dynapower has provided power electronics solutions, along with an array of aftermarket services focused on continuous reliability and efficiency to an ever-expanding global customer base. We are a trusted leader in all types of power conversion equipment including high power rectifiers, inverters, DC/DC converters, integrated battery energy storage systems and transformers for use in hydrogen, e-mobility, energy storage, industrial, mining, defense and research applications. With headquarters and a 150,000 square-foot vertically integrated manufacturing facility in South Burlington, VT, Dynapower is collaborating with our partners and clients to shift the way our world uses power and advance our resilient, clean energy future.
